Morfa Mawddach to Adderley Park by train

Planning a train journey from Morfa Mawddach to Adderley Park? The trip usually takes about 3hrs 54 mins, covering approximately 92 miles (149 kilometres). With roughly 6 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£16.40,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Morfa Mawddach to Adderley Park start from as little as £16.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Morfa Mawddach to Adderley Park are available for £39.70 one way, or £40.40 return

Facilities at Morfa Mawddach

It's important to note that Morfa Mawddach station doesn't have a ticket office or ticket machines, so you'll need to secure your train tickets in advance or through online purchases. While this might mean a little extra planning, it also ensures you can focus on what's most important—enjoying the journey. The station provides minimal facilities, which only helps in preserving its serene atmosphere. With step-free access to platform areas, it holds a Category B2 accessibility rating. This makes it somewhat convenient for individuals with reduced mobility, although it's worth checking ahead if assistance is needed during your travels.

Onward Travel Options

Even with its quaint nature, Morfa Mawddach offers multiple transport links for further exploration. During service disruptions, a rail replacement bus service is accessible from the station’s car park. Local bus services can be found approximately 650 meters away on the A493, leading to exciting places like Dolgellau, Aberystwyth, and Machynlleth. Do keep in mind that while bicycle hire is mentioned, there are no actual facilities at the station, so arranging cycling plans in advance would be prudent. These connections make it simple to reach nearby attractions and experience Welsh culture and landscapes.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Adderley Park station ensures travel convenience with ticket machines available for those who purchase tickets online. While there is no dedicated ticket office on Mondays, staff presence is available on most days. Travelers can expect helpful departure screens and announcements to stay updated about their journey. Although the station lacks fully accessible facilities, step-free access is partially available, and ramps can be provided for train access upon request.

The station doesn’t currently offer some amenities like refreshment facilities, but its strategic location means there's always something nearby in Birmingham to quench your thirst or satisfy any snack cravings. While toilets and baby changing facilities are also unavailable, the station is under CCTV surveillance, adding a layer of security for travelers and their properties. For bikers, a small cycling storage area is present, albeit unsheltered.

Onward Travel Options

Adderley Park is not just about train travel. It integrates seamlessly with other local transport options, offering easier navigation around the bustling city of Birmingham and beyond. In the case of rail service disruptions, rail replacement vehicles board from Bordesley Green Road, right outside the station entrance. Local bus services by West Midlands buses provide frequent and robust connections throughout the city. For those looking to travel comfortably without a personal ride, taxis are readily available with local companies like Embassy and TOA, which can be contacted for services directly to your next destination.
